Smokeless Fuel
Multi fuel stoves give you more flexibility in heating your home because they can burn smokeless fuels in addition to wood. If you reside in the Smoke Control Area, choosing a DEFRA approved multi-fuel stove is a great option for ensuring compliance and making your home cleaner.
The stove's design plays a major role in causing more particulate emissions due to the combustion of solid fuels. The emission factor values are affected by the design of the combustion room, operator behaviour, and the way fuel is stacked within the stove. These factors can also influence the composition of PM in diluted and cooled flue gas.
Certain stoves, such as have a second setting which directs air over fuel to regulate the rate of combustion when using highly volatile fuels. Some stoves have a grate as well as an ash pan which enables the ashes to fall into a centrally-located tray, instead of the chimney. This ensures that the ash doesn't block the air supply.
Some stoves also have air inlets that are tertiary, which can further enhance the combustion process and contribute to less harmful flue gas emissions. These extra air intakes are often a feature of modern multifuel stoves, and they aid in achieving high-efficiency levels required for the clearSkies certification.

It is important to determine the space where you'll use the multi-fuel stove before purchasing it. All multi-fuel stoves are required to conform to UK building codes. There are also specifications about how high the flue is allowed to be and how far it should be from combustible materials.
Simply take measurements of the length and width, as well as the height in metres to calculate your room's size. Divide this by 14 if you have a room with good insulation or 12 if the insulation is average and 10 if it has poor insulation. This will give you an approximate kW output that your stove must have to be able of heating your room.
